Why Speed and Depth Aren't Opposites
Most people assume that learning quickly means skimming the surface — absorbing just enough to get by before moving on. That trade-off feels intuitive, but it isn't inevitable. The real bottleneck usually isn't how fast you consume information; it's how well your brain stores and retrieves it.
Research in cognitive science consistently shows that the way you practice matters far more than the raw hours you put in. You can make faster, more durable progress by aligning your study methods with how memory actually works — without sacrificing genuine understanding.

Break the skill into the smallest learnable units before you begin.
Large, vague goals overwhelm working memory and make it hard to know where to focus. Decomposing a skill into specific sub-skills lets you direct practice precisely where you're weakest. This is especially effective for beginners who can't yet see what they don't know.
Use retrieval practice instead of re-reading or re-watching material.
Cognitive psychology research consistently shows that actively recalling information strengthens memory far more than passive review. Each retrieval attempt, even an imperfect one, reinforces the neural pathway associated with that knowledge.
Space your practice sessions rather than massing them into one long block.
Distributed practice — sometimes called spaced repetition — takes advantage of how memory consolidates during the gaps between sessions. Cramming may feel productive, but retention drops sharply without those recovery intervals.
Practice at the edge of your current ability, not comfortably inside it.
Skills improve when practice introduces manageable difficulty. If every session feels easy, you're rehearsing what you already know. Slight discomfort — making mistakes and correcting them — is a sign your brain is being challenged to adapt.
Treat rest and sleep as non-negotiable parts of the learning process.
Memory consolidation — the process by which new information becomes stable, long-term knowledge — happens largely during sleep. Skipping rest to squeeze in more study time is counterproductive; it undermines the consolidation of what you've already learned.

Building Feedback Into Your Routine
One of the most underused levers in self-directed learning is structured feedback. Many beginners wait until they feel confident before seeking input — but that's backwards. Early, regular feedback prevents small misunderstandings from hardening into habits that are much harder to unlearn later.
Feedback doesn't have to come from an expert. A peer, a recording of yourself, or even a self-evaluation checklist can surface gaps you'd otherwise miss. The key is building it in systematically rather than treating it as an occasional check-in.
